The median salary for Mechanical Engineer roles in Spain is $119,000 per year. Most pay falls between $118,600 (25th percentile) and $124,800 (75th percentile), with the broader 10th–90th percentile band running from $70,777 to $146,640.
These figures are computed live from 17 active Mechanical Engineer roles in Spain on JobsRadar, of which 5 (29.4%) publish a salary range. Pay is normalized to annualized USD so roles can be compared on equal terms; the highest-paying roles listed above show their original posted currency. Numbers refresh every few hours as new roles are posted and older ones close.
Employers currently hiring well-paid Mechanical Engineer roles in Spain include micro1, GE Vernova, HP and Baker Hughes.
Salary transparency varies by employer and region, so the disclosing share above reflects only roles that publish pay — not every open position. Use it as a directional benchmark rather than an exact offer.
